…says victory a testament of previous service, commitment to people’s welfare

All Progressives Congress Chieftain Engineer Muritala Salau Audu has described the election of the new Governor of Kogi State Alhaji Ahmed Usman Ododo as a testament and positive consequence of his past service and dedication to ensuring a seamless government in the state.

In a congratulatory message signed and issued by Engr. Audu on Sunday, he cited various contributions of the Governor-elect Alhaji Ododo while serving as the Auditor-General of the state adding that his selfless comportment has been rewarded by the Kogi state people through the ballot box and their overwhelming votes for him on Saturday 11th November,2023, having been declared winner by the Independent National Commission (INEC) polling 446,237 valid votes to defeat his closest contender in the SDP who polled 259,052 votes while PDP and ADC polled 46,362 and 21,819 votes respectively.

Audu said that: “On behalf of the people of Kogi State and the All Progressives Congress (APC), I extend my warmest congratulations to Alhaji Ahmed Usman Ododo on his well-deserved emergence as the Governor-elect of Kogi State. Alhaji Ahmed Usman Ododo’s victory at the gubernatorial election is a testament to the trust and confidence that the people of Kogi State have in his leadership abilities.

“His track record as the former Auditor of Kogi state Cabinet, coupled with his experience as a member Kogi State Government, showcases his dedication and commitment to public service.

According to Engr.Audu the Aare Atunluse Omoluwabi Oodua Worldwide, Alhaji Ahmed Ododo will bring to bear his expertise and leadership acumen in the management of the system of government and the people of the state going forward. “His work with the Kogi State government, and various other levels and assignments reflect his wealth of experience and competence in public administration.

“As a former Local Government Auditor-General, Alhaji Ahmed Usman Ododo has contributed significantly to the fiscal accountability and transparency of our local government system. His stint at the energy sector further demonstrates his diverse and valuable expertise in key sectors.

 “I am confident that Kogi State will benefit immensely from his visionary leadership and passion for public service. His wealth of experience, combined with his youthful energy, positions him as a leader who can drive positive change and development in our beloved state.”

The APC Chieftain Engr. Audu however, counseled all well-meaning residents of Kogi State to rally behind Alhaji Ahmed Usman Ododo as he embarks on this important journey. “Let us unite and support his candidacy, ensuring that together, we build a Kogi State that thrives economically, socially, and politically.

He further urged Ododo to run an open-door policy in government by ensuring a deliberate accommodation of all shades of political interest to elicit an inclusive government, he also prayed for a prosperous tenure in office, also for a united and progressive Kogi State.
